IGN Wii the most biased? Have you ever really read through a bunch of their Wii reviews? They are extremely harsh on games. Heck, they often get slammed for being so harsh by some Wii owners. How many 9.0+ scores have they given to Wii games? The only one that comes to mind is Twilight Princess. There are a lot of 5s and 6s in that review list. In fact there are a lot of people right now bitching in the comments section of the MP3 review at Matt and Bozon for not giving the game a higher score. It isn't simply IGN that gushes on this game and the Prime series in general, it's pretty much every other site as well. On gamerankings.com the original Prime is 3rd all time with an average score of 96.3%. It's in the same company as Ocarina of Time, Bioshock, Halo, Tekken 3, RE4, Goldeneye, and Mario 64 on that site.
What you really meant to say was you weren't happy that they gave this game a high score therefore you are going to blast them.

Let me also add one thing: I'm not upset that IGN is as hard on Wii games as they are. I like that. I don't want some reviewer to tell me a game is good only to buy it and find a bunch of bad things they didn't tell me about. I like knowing the good and bad when I buy a game. For instance, with Madden 08 Bozon mentioned the possible online lag issues. It hasn't bothered me so far, but had he not mentioned it and I had problems I would have been pissed off. I don't want to be BSed. Is the game good or bad and why? Matt and Bozon are typically pretty good at this.
There is a backlash right now over the PS3 reviewers giving Heavenly Sword a 7.0. They told people what they thought of the game. If someone buys the game and finds that it is repetitive and short, well the review told them that ahead of time.
